Obama's religious label shouldn't matter; his actions should - http://newsweek.washingtonpost.com/onfaith...
"In the wake of his weekend rally, Glenn Beck kept up the drumbeat of criticism about President Obama's religion, calling it a "perversion" and saying that America "isn't recognizing his version of Christianity," which Beck characterized as "liberation theology." Despite critique of Obama's Christianity, a recent poll showed that nearly 20% of Americans believe falsely that the president is Muslim. Why is there so much attention on Obama's religion? Does it matter what religion the president is?" - April from Bookmarklet

Wasn't a big deal made of the fact that JFK was the first Catholic President? I wasn't around but I seem to recall seeing some history stuff about that (and Irish to boot!). - Kenton
From Wikipedia: "To address fears that the fact that he was Catholic would impact his decision-making, he famously told the Greater Houston Ministerial Association on September 12, 1960, "I am not the Catholic candidate for President. I am the Democratic Party candidate for President who also happens to be a Catholic. I do not speak for my Church on public matters — and the Church does not speak for me." - Kenton
